Enjoy fresh and delicious Italian-inspired fare at Seattle’s Cornelly.
The restaurant impresses with handmade pasta, naturally leavened pizza, and local veggies.
The spot is open Tuesday through Sunday, from 4 to 9 pm.

Cornelly has six types of pizza.
Pick between the classic Margherita, three cheese, pepperoni, or red sauce and cheese, or try something new such as the green ranger with maitake mushrooms, hand-stretched mozzarella, pea vine, herbed chevre, and chili oil, or the flying sauser with fennel sausage, house-made ricotta, and thyme.

For pasta, Cornelli serves up four different dishes. We’re obsessed with the orecchiette dish with flowering kale, parsley anchovy butter, preserved lemon, Marcona almonds, and grana padano, as well as the strozzapreti with whey braised lamb, crème fraîche, English peas, and mint.
